Taste of Durham Festival
The Taste of Durham Festival is the first large-scale project design produced by The Community Chest, Inc. to serve life-enriching opportunities in various levels for many members of various communities. The second annual Taste of Durham Festival on May 27, 2006 was another overwhelming success. The distinctive international food and entertainment festival brought up to 15,000 people from Durham, Triangle communities, and beyond. Our quality-driven destination festival is geared to make a day to remember for the many hungering for a slice of the good life for years to come.
The commitment is to create a festival with distinction and to showcase high-quality entertainment. This unique festival is infused with international arts and cultural experiences, eclectic food sampling, an opportunity to experience a wide variety of music genres, an international dance showcase, wine and beer tasting from around the world, and many other opportunities for all ages to celebrate the good life and cultural experiences. These high-caliber gathering venues also allow area businesses, corporations, and organizations to connect directly with an attentive audience from various communities and to promote their business.
